What are the requirements to request an operating license for a health center in Costa Rica?
The requirements to apply for an operating license for a health center in Costa Rica include submitting an application to the Ministry of Health, meeting the infrastructure and medical equipment requirements, having trained personnel, and complying with established health and safety standards. , among other specific requirements established by the ministry.

What are the financing options available for renewable energy development projects in Honduras?
In Honduras, there are financing options for renewable energy development projects. These options include loans and lines of credit offered by financial institutions specialized in renewable energy, government programs to support clean energy generation, international funds that support renewable energy projects, and collaborations with private investors and companies in the energy sector. In addition, there are tax incentives and preferential rates to promote investment in renewable energy in the country.
